Let me tell you, Bitcoin (BTC) thought it was having a moment, what with a 3% surge that took it from $84,000 to $88,600 in just 24 hours. But guess what? It’s like Bitcoin decided to take a nap, because the altcoins are where the real party is happening. 🎶

Solana (SOL), Dogecoin (DOGE), and Cardano (ADA) are stealing the show, leading the pack of the ten largest cryptocurrencies. It’s like they’re the cool kids at the cryptocurrency dance, and Bitcoin is stuck in the corner, awkwardly trying to join in.

Apparently, all this excitement is thanks to some good news from the White House. You know, the folks who sometimes seem to thrive on creating trade tensions. President Trump, who once threatened to impose tariffs on Canada, China, and Mexico, is now considering a more… let’s say, measured approach. 📝

Anonymous sources, because nothing says “trust me” like an anonymous source, suggest that Trump might focus on reciprocal tariffs instead of sector-specific ones. This shift is being hailed as a sign of a more temperate trade policy, which is great news for everyone who likes stable markets. 🌈

Dan Greer, CEO of the oh-so-decentralized Defi App, pointed out the connection between the tariff news and Bitcoin’s price hike. “It’s like the tariffs decided to take a chill pill, and Bitcoin decided to throw a block party,” he quipped. 🌠

And it’s not just Bitcoin getting all the love. Ethereum, XRP, and the aforementioned altcoin trio are all seeing gains, making the crypto market look like a big, happy family reunion. 🥳 The stock market is in on the fun too, with the Nasdaq and S&P 500 both up 2%.

Colin Closser, the investor relations manager at Exodus, summed it up nicely: “Markets are like teenagers, they overreact to everything. And today, they’re overreacting to the good news.”

But don’t get too comfy, crypto enthusiasts. Bitcoin’s surge was followed by a little pullback to around $86,930, with a support floor between $83,000 and $84,000. It’s like Bitcoin is playing a game of crypto Jenga—exciting, but a bit nerve-wracking. 🧩
